The car is overheating but ck eng light not coming on. The transmission catches hard intermittently. The rpms seem to be running higher than normal.

check for low coolant level.check coolant overflow jug if it is empty, more likely air is in the coolant system.add more coolant to overflow jug until coolant level stay at cold full mark,dont over fill coolant overflow jug.if all is good, to be on the safe side, replace radiator cap,replace thermostat,if your engine overheat at a long slow driving traffic.or long stop idling, if cooling fan dont turn on more likely engine coolant temperature sensor could be faulty.

Clunking noise comming from front

check your lug nuts first. if there tight jack the front of the car off the ground, then wiggle the tire left to right and up and down. if you have any play then your wheel bearings are out. if you dont have play then reach around to where your front wheel drive axle attaches and wiggle it in the same fassion. you should have your answer when you do this to both sides

Car overheating, coolant blowing out of overflow

without knowing much about the particulars of the car I am at first inclined to go with what the computer says. HOWEVER I also happen to know if you have a bad or stuck thermostat not letting the coolant flow correctly it too can trick the computer into a head gasket error code. Most times you can get a new thermostat for less than $15.00 and change it yourself. It's usually 2 bolts. If you change it and still get the same result look at it as cheap insurance and then you'll know someone isn't trying to take advantage of you by telling you it's head gasket when it really isn't. Head gasket job's aren't cheap I would want to make sure before I spent that kind of money.

Can i sand a flywheel and put it back in

If the surface is still smooth with no visible cracks, gouges, ridges, grooves, or deep impressions, or bluish tint indicating possible heat distortions, then yes, use a circular motion with the sandpaper. If you feel ridges or any roughness whatsoever when you run your fingertips around the flywheel's clutch disc face, then have it turned smooth by a machine shop. Any doubts at all about the surface, have it brought back to perfect smooth by a shop. Otherwise, clutch will slip and chatter. Turning it is always recommended, but not necessarily always needed. By turning, I mean the shop would cut and remove the surface to the lowest groove point and smooth it out from there. I have put clutches in without turning the flywheel at a shop, but I got a trusted mechanic's opinion first. His frank advice was, If it's on an older car, smooth is smooth.
